Dr. Insha Afzal is a Poultry Scientist and academician from the Indian state of Jammu & Kashmir. She was born and raised in the region and completed her secondary and higher secondary education from the JK Board of School Education with distinction and first division, respectively. She then pursued a Bachelor of Veterinary Science (B.V.Sc) from the Faculty of Veterinary Science & Animal Husbandry, SKUAST-K, in 2014.
Dr. Afzal continued her education and obtained a Master of Veterinary Science (M.V.Sc) degree in Poultry Science from the same institution in 2016, where she also cleared the National Eligibility Test (NET). She later completed her Ph.D. in Poultry Science from the Faculty of Veterinary Sciences & Animal Husbandry, SKUAST-K, in 2021.
During her academic tenure, Dr. Afzal was engaged in various research projects and worked on a dissertation titled “Effect of Pre and Post Hatch Cold Conditioning on the Performance of Poultry” in the Division of Livestock Production & Management under the supervision of Prof.(Dr.) Azmat Alam Khan. She also evaluated the efficacy of Bovine Colostrum as a feed additive in Broiler Chicken in another research project titled “Evaluation of Bovine Colostrum as feed additive in Broiler Chicken.”
Besides research and academics, Dr. Afzal also gained practical experience in Veterinary Medicine and Livestock production. She completed a six-month internship program in various veterinary departments of the Government of J&K in 2014. Subsequently, she worked as a vocational trainer at Govt. High School Raithan, Budgam, J&K from 2019 to 2021, and served as an SRF at Div of Vety. Biochemistry, FVSC & AH, SKUAST-K from 2021-2022.
Dr. Afzal has actively participated in several workshops, conferences, and seminars to enhance her skills and knowledge in Poultry Science. Some of her notable contributions include attending a training program on “Entrepreneurship Awareness” organized by MSME-Technology Development Centre, Foundry Nagar Agra, and a national conference on “Innovative Technological Interventions for Doubling Farmers Income(NaCITI-2018)” organized by SIDAVES where she presented two papers on the economics of production of Broiler Chicken and conformational traits of Broiler Chicken fed Broiler Colostrum Supplemented Diets. She also presented a paper on “Immunomodulatory effect of Bovine Colostrum and Mortality Pattern in Broiler Chicken” in a national seminar on “Animal Science Congress: Horizons in Zoological Studies” organized by the Department of Zoology, University of Kashmir, and another paper on “Effect of Incorporation of Bovine Colostrum in Broiler Chicken Diets on Performance Parameters” at an international conference on “Worldwide Research Initiatives for Agriculture, Science & Technology” organized by National Agriculture Development Co-operative Ltd.
